Definition
To do something that makes it likely you will get a negative result or trouble, especially because of your own actions.

Listen in Context
He knew the dog was angry, but he still teased it and asked for it.
If you break the rules, you're asking for it.
He touched the hot stove and burned himself—he really asked for it.
Don't complain about getting wet if you forgot your umbrella—you asked for it.
